anyone keep a car in midtown? How much is parking a month?

I just got a monthly spot using spot hero for $350! 1755 Broadway.

Check spot hero for any monthly deals. But generally $500 a month in midtown

I’m sure it’s at least $500/month

It's $300 in Queens.

I know it’s $500 in the UWS and I imagine it’s more in midtown
